Background:
- Hepatitis B virus (HBV) infection is a major global health concern, with 350 million chronic carriers worldwide.
- Prevalence varies significantly by region, impacting disease transmission routes and management strategies.
- Chronic HBV infection can lead to severe liver disease, including cirrhosis and liver cancer.

Main Results:
- Interferon alpha treatment for chronic Hepatitis B has significant drawbacks, including cost, administration route, and side effects.
- Lamivudine, a nucleoside analogue, is the first effective and well-tolerated oral treatment for chronic Hepatitis B.
- Lamivudine expands therapeutic options for chronic HBV patients.
Conclusions:
- While eradication of Hepatitis B remains a challenge, lamivudine represents a significant advancement in managing chronic HBV-associated liver disease.
- The development of oral therapies like lamivudine is crucial for addressing the global public health burden of Hepatitis B.
- Lamivudine offers improved accessibility and tolerability for a broader patient population.
